How This Service Actually Works
Our stucco water damage repair process is designed to get the job done fast, while still ensuring a thorough repair. We’ll start by assessing the damage and developing a plan to dry out your walls and repair any affected areas.
Step 1: Assessment
Our technicians will arrive at your home and assess the damage, using specialized equipment to detect moisture and identify any affected areas. This is a crucial step in ensuring a thorough repair.
Step 2: Containment
We’ll set up containment procedures to prevent further water damage and protect your belongings. This might involve setting up tarps or plastic sheets to cover affected areas.
Step 3: Drying
Our team will use specialized equipment to dry out your walls, including dehumidifiers and air movers. We’ll work to remove as much moisture as possible to prevent further damage.
Step 4: Repair
Once your walls are dry, we’ll repair any affected areas, including replacing damaged stucco and patching holes.
Step 5: Inspection and Final Touches
Our team will inspect your home to ensure everything is dry and in good condition. We’ll make any necessary adjustments to ensure a thorough repair.

Stucco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Minor water stains on a small area | Yes | No | DIY repair is usually enough for minor stains on small areas. |
| Water damage covering a large area | No | Yes | Large water damage areas need specialized equipment and expertise to repair correctly. |
| You’re not sure where the water is coming from | No | Yes | Our team can help identify the source of the problem and repair it quickly. |
| You’re not comfortable with heights or ladders | No | Yes | Our team is equipped to handle stucco repairs at heights, so you can stay safe. |
| You’re not sure what type of stucco you have | No | Yes | Our team will help identify the type of stucco on your home and recommend the best repair method. |
| You’ve tried DIY repair, but it didn’t work | No | Yes |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and repair it correctly. |
Not every situation needs a professional, but many do. If you’re unsure, it’s always better to err on the side of caution and call a pro to assess the damage and recommend the best course of action.
Stucco Water Damage Repair Cost In Saltillo, MS
The cost of stucco water damage repair can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Saltillo, MS.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Inspection | $200 – $500 | Severity and size of affected area |
| Containment and Drying |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and equipment needed |
| Repair and Patching |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area and type of repair needed |
| Final Inspection and Touch-ups |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and type of repair needed |
| Moisture Mapping (optional) |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and equipment needed |
| Water Damage Restoration (whole house) | $5,000 – $20,000 | Size of affected area and type of damage |
Keep in mind that these are estimates, and the actual cost of stucco water damage repair will depend on the specifics of your situation. Our team will provide a free estimate after assessing the damage.
